What to do right now
- If anyone is in danger, call 911.
- If safe, stop the water source (main shutoff or appliance valve).
- Stay clear of electricity and standing water near outlets.
- Keep children and pets away from affected areas.
- Photograph damage for insurance before major cleanup.

Common causes in Latah
Knowing the likely source in Latah helps you shut the right valve and brief a contractor faster.
- Supply-line failures (washer hoses, fridge lines, angle stops under sinks)
- Water heater tank or pan failures
- Storm-driven intrusion, roof leaks after wind, or window well overflow
- Slab or underground leak symptoms (warm floors, unexplained high bills)
- Appliance faults (dishwasher, ice maker, HVAC condensate)

For your insurer
- Photos or short video before major cleanup
- When the water started and what you shut off
- Receipts for emergency purchases
- Contractor assessment when available
- Do not discard large damaged items until your insurer says it is OK when possible.
